Renewal of your annual lease with subscription benefits on your Autodesk Education license does not automatically continue your existing license. Your currently installed license will time out and cease to operate if you do not follow through on one of the options below.

Once you renew your Autodesk Lease with Subscription you have immediate access to the 2012 product via download through the Autodesk Subscription Site. If you would like physical media shipped to you, Autodesk will send you the DVDs free of charge. Simply login to the Autodesk Subscription Site and request it. To complete the set-up on your end , you have three options:

Option 1: If you have not already done so you can download, install and use the new 2012 version from the subscription site using your 2012 serial number.

Option 2: If you have previously downloaded and installed the 2012 version you still need to take some additional steps to avoid a time-out of your licenses.

For Network Installs:* The license file which currently resides on your server will expire and needs to be replaced. To obtain a new license file contact Autodesk Authorizations at 800-551-1490 or via email at [email protected] with your school name, 2012 serial number, quantity of seats, server name and Mac address. It is often helpful to email your old license file in with your request.

For Standalone Installs:** Your 2012 software will time out and cease to function. To extend its use you must generate new request codes from each workstation and then contact Autodesk Authorizations with those codes at 800-551-1490 or via email at [email protected] to get a new authorization code that you can plug in at each workstation. If you fail to do this prior to the time-out of your software and your software freezes, you will have to do a clean uninstall of the product and reinstall.

Option 3: In addition per your subscription benefits, you can opt to continue to run a currently installed version such as 2010 or 2011 but you will need to get a new serial number and a new license file or re-authorization to avoid a time-out. You cannot continue to run your currently installed 2011 or 2010 serial number, it will time out.

First, you will need to log into the Autodesk Subscription Site and request a previous version serial number. Once you have a new 2010 or 2011 serial number you can complete the process below.

For Network Installs:* The license file which currently resides on your server needs to be replaced. To obtain a new license file contact Autodesk Authorizations at 800-551-1490 or via email at [email protected] with your school name, new 2010 or 2011 serial number, quantity of seats, server name and Mac address. It is often helpful to email your old license file in with your request.

For Standalone Installs:** You must generate new request codes from each workstation using your new 2010 or 2011 serial number and then contact Autodesk Authorizations with those codes at 800-551-1490 or via email at [email protected] to get a new authorization code that needs to be plugged in at each workstation. If you fail to do this prior to the time-out of your software and your software freezes, you will have to do a clean uninstall of the product and reinstall.

To Check Your Time Out Dates:

*Network licenses can be checked from LMTools or by browsing to the license file and   opening it with Notepad. Unless the license type is Permanent, there will be a timeout value embedded in the file that is usually the contract date of your existing license.

**For standalone license you can easily check to see if your software is set to timeout.

(Note: This only works if the software has not timed out.)
